CSW Location Agent
The csw-location-agent project provides an application used to register and track non-csw services, such as Redis, which is used to implement the Event and Alarm Services.
See here for the command line usage.
The LocationAgent class executes the given shell command in the background, registers it using the location service HTTP API, then waits for it to complete before unregistering it.
Log messages are configured in application.conf to log only to file (under $TMT_LOG_HOME/csw/logs).
0.7.0-RC1